The efficient field environment in arithmetic coding involves decoding the scan order of the current block and decoding the entropy transformation coefficients from the current block. The entropy decoding includes: Based on the scanning sequence, determine the position between the scanning sequence corresponding to the entropy code transform coefficients and correspond to the first field boundary coefficient scanning sequence of the position of the first scanning order from field boundary distance; numerical coefficient registers in the first position in a scene recognition system, corresponding to the first position the first scanning order distance, the scene is a scene coefficient coefficient register register size decrease, and the first scene based on numerical entropy decoding on the entropy code transformation coefficient.
【技术实现步骤摘要】
【国外来华专利技术】在算术代码化中的有效率场境应对
技术介绍
例如,数字视频可以用于经由视频会议、高清晰度视频娱乐、视频广告、或用户生成的视频的共享进行远程商务会议。由于视频数据中包括大量数据,因此对于传输和存储需要高效能压缩。因此,提供通过具有有限带宽的通信信道传送的高分辨率视频将是有利的。
技术实现思路
本文公开了用于使用在算术代码化中的有效率场境(context)应对进行编码和解码的系统、方法、和装置的方面。一个方面是一种使用在算术代码化中的有效率场境应对进行视频编码的方法。该方法可以包括:从经编码视频流中识别来自当前帧的当前块(block),识别对于所述当前块的扫描顺序,从所述当前块识别当前熵代码化变换系数,以及对所述当前熵代码化变换系数进行熵解码。所述熵解码可以包括:基于所述扫描顺序,确定在与所述当前熵代码化变换系数相对应的扫描顺序位置和与第一场境系数相对应的扫描顺序位置之间的第一扫描顺序距离,其中与第一场境系数相对应的扫描顺序位置在空间上接近与所述当前熵代码化变换系数相对应的扫描顺序位置;从场境系数寄存器中的第一位置识别第一场境系数值,所述第一位置对应于所述第一扫描顺序距离,其中所 ...
【技术保护点】
一种方法,包括:从经编码的视频流识别来自当前帧的当前块;识别对于所述当前块的扫描顺序;从所述当前块识别当前熵代码化变换系数;由处理器响应于存储在非暂时性计算机可读介质上的指令对所述当前熵代码化变换系数进行熵解码,其中,对所述当前熵代码化变换系数进行熵解码包括:基于所述扫描顺序,确定在与所述当前熵代码化变换系数相对应的扫描顺序位置和与第一场境系数相对应的扫描顺序位置之间的第一扫描顺序距离,其中与第一场境系数相对应的所述扫描顺序位置在空间上接近与所述当前熵代码化变换系数相对应的所述扫描顺序位置,从场境系数寄存器中的第一位置识别第一场境系数值,所述第一位置对应于所述第一扫描顺序距 ...
【技术特征摘要】
【国外来华专利技术】2015.01.19 US 14/599,7731.一种方法,包括:从经编码的视频流识别来自当前帧的当前块;识别对于所述当前块的扫描顺序;从所述当前块识别当前熵代码化变换系数;由处理器响应于存储在非暂时性计算机可读介质上的指令对所述当前熵代码化变换系数进行熵解码,其中,对所述当前熵代码化变换系数进行熵解码包括:基于所述扫描顺序,确定在与所述当前熵代码化变换系数相对应的扫描顺序位置和与第一场境系数相对应的扫描顺序位置之间的第一扫描顺序距离,其中与第一场境系数相对应的所述扫描顺序位置在空间上接近与所述当前熵代码化变换系数相对应的所述扫描顺序位置,从场境系数寄存器中的第一位置识别第一场境系数值,所述第一位置对应于所述第一扫描顺序距离,其中所述场境系数寄存器是减小大小的场境系数寄存器,以及基于所述第一场境系数值来对所述当前熵代码化变换系数进行熵解码;将经熵解码的当前变换系数包括在用于显示的输出比特流中;以及存储或显示所述输出比特流。2.根据权利要求1所述的方法,其中,对所述当前熵代码化变换系数进行熵解码包括:基于所述扫描顺序,确定在与所述当前熵代码化变换系数相对应的所述扫描顺序位置和与第二场境系数相对应的扫描顺序位置之间的第二扫描顺序距离,其中与第二场境系数相对应的所述扫描顺序位置在空间上接近与所述当前熵代码化变换系数相对应的所述扫描顺序位置;从所述场境系数寄存器中的第二位置识别第二场境系数值,所述第二位置对应于所述第二扫描顺序距离;以及基于所述第一场境系数值和所述第二场境系数值来对所述当前熵代码化变换系数进行熵解码。3.根据权利要求2所述的方法,其中,所述第一扫描顺序位置在与第二场境系数相对应的所述扫描顺序位置的左方,并且所述第二扫描顺序位置在与第二场境系数相对应的所述扫描顺序位置的上方。4.根据权利要求1所述的方法,其中,对所述当前熵代码化变换系数进行熵解码包括:针对所述扫描顺序,从扫描顺序距离表中识别所述第一扫描顺序距离。5.根据权利要求4所述的方法,其中,确定所述第一扫描顺序距离包括:识别所述扫描顺序距离表,使得所述扫描顺序距离表包括针对在所述扫描顺序中的每个扫描顺序位置的左方场境系数扫描顺序距离和上方场境系数扫描顺序距离。6.根据权利要求1所述的方法,其中,对所述当前熵代码化变换系数进行熵解码包括:将所述场境系数寄存器的大小确定为小于针对所述扫描顺序的扫描顺序距离的最大值的大小。7.根据权利要求1所述的方法,其中,对所述当前熵代码化变换系数进行熵解码包括:执行移位操作以将经熵解码的当前变换系数包括在所述场境系数寄存器中。8.一种方法,包括:从经编码的视频流识别来自当前帧的当前块;识别对于所述当前块的扫描顺序;从所述当前块识别当前熵代码化变换系数;由处理器响应于存储在非暂时性计算机可读介质上的指令对所述当前熵代码化变换系数进行熵解码,其中,对所述当前熵代码化变换系数进行熵解码包括:基于所述扫描顺序,确定在与所述当前熵代码化变换系数相对应的扫描顺序位置和与第一场境系数相对应的扫描顺序位置之间的第一扫描顺序距离,其中与第一场境系数相对应的所述扫描顺序位置在空间上接近与所述当前熵代码化变换系数相对应的所述扫描顺序位置,从场境系数寄存器中的第一位置识别第一场境系数值,所述第一位置对应于所述第一扫描顺序距离,其中所述场境系数寄存器是减小大小的场境系数寄存器,基于所述扫描顺序,确定在与所述当前熵代码化变换系数相对应的所述扫描顺序位置和与第二场境系数相对应的扫描顺序位置之间的第二扫描顺序距离,其中与第二场境系...
【专利技术属性】
技术研发人员:亚科·图奥马斯·阿莱克希·文泰莱,
申请(专利权)人:谷歌公司,
类型:发明
国别省市:美国,US
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。